システム開発コラム集
Aceessでのシステム開発に関するコラム集です。
48.システム開発でよく聞く「人月単価」とは何か?
人月単価は、システム開発プロジェクトにおける費用計算や進捗管理において不可欠な要素です。
この概念は、1人の開発者が1ヶ月間働くことに対する費用を表します。
例えば、開発チームが10人で、1人月の単価が10万円だとします。
この場合、1ヶ月間の開発コストは100万円となります。この金額は、開発者の人数や働く期間に応じて変動します。
人月単価の理解が重要なのはなぜでしょうか?
まず第一に、予算管理において、プロジェクトの総費用を見積もる必要があります。
開発に必要なリソースを正確に把握し、予算内でプロジェクトを進めるために、人月単価を理解することが不可欠です。
次に、進捗管理において、プロジェクトの進行状況を把握するためにも人月単価は重要です。
開発者が何ヶ月分の作業を行ったかを正確に把握し、費用として変換することで、プロジェクトの進捗を的確に把握することができます。
さらに、リソースの配分においても、人月単価は役立ちます。
開発者の数や働く期間を調整することで、プロジェクトの進行を最適化し、生産性を最大化することができます。適切なリソースの配置は、プロジェクトの成功に直結する要素です。
要するに、「人月単価」はプロジェクト管理において欠かせない要素であり、予算管理、進捗管理、リソース配分の各段階で重要な役割を果たします。開発会社との契約やプロジェクトの計画段階で、この概念を理解し、適切に活用することが成功への鍵となります。
もちろんです。人月単価は、1人の開発者が1ヶ月間働くことに対する費用を表します。例えば、開発チームが10人で、1人月の単価が10万円だとします。すると、1ヶ月間の開発コストは100万円になります。この金額は、人数と働く期間に応じて変動します。
なぜ「人月単価」が重要なのでしょうか?
-
予算管理: プロジェクトのコストを管理するために、開発に必要なリソースを理解し、予算内で進行させることが必要です。
人月単価を知ることで、プロジェクトの総費用を見積もることができます。 -
進捗管理: プロジェクトの進行状況を把握するために、開発者が何ヶ月分働いたかを計算する必要があります。
人月単価を使えば、開発者の作業時間を費用に変換し、進捗を追跡することができます。 -
リソース配分: 開発者の数や期間を調整することで、プロジェクトの進行を最適化することができます。
人月単価を知ることで、必要なリソースを効果的に配置し、生産性を最大化することができます。